Kenneth Lofton Jr.

American basketball player

October 29 2024 Kenneth Lofton Jr. signed a contract with the Shanghai Sharks of the Chinese Basketball Association.

October 17 2024 Kenneth Lofton Jr. was waived by the Chicago Bulls.

August 15 2024 Kenneth Lofton Jr. signed with the Chicago Bulls.

July 24 2024 Kenneth Lofton Jr. was waived by the Utah Jazz.

March 11 2024 Kenneth Lofton Jr. signed with the Utah Jazz.

March 1 2024 Kenneth Lofton Jr. was waived by the Philadelphia 76ers.

2023 Lofton was named to the G League's inaugural Next Up Game for the 2022–23 season, recognizing him as an outstanding player in the league.

December 23 2023 Kenneth Lofton Jr. signed a two-way contract with the Philadelphia 76ers and their G League affiliate, the Delaware Blue Coats.

December 18 2023 Kenneth Lofton Jr. was waived by the Memphis Grizzlies.

April 9 2023 Lofton scored a career-high 42 points and grabbed 14 rebounds in his first game as a starter, making him the first player in NBA history to achieve over 40 points and 10 rebounds in a player's first career start.

April 8 2023 The Memphis Grizzlies converted Lofton's two-way contract into a standard, multi-year NBA contract.

March 31 2023 Lofton was awarded the NBA G League Rookie of the Year Award, highlighting his exceptional performance during the season.

2022 Kenneth Lofton Jr. received first-team honors as a sophomore while playing for the Louisiana Tech Bulldogs in Conference USA.

October 22 2022 Lofton made his NBA debut, scoring four points in a game where the Memphis Grizzlies lost to the Dallas Mavericks 137–96.

July 2 2022 Kenneth Lofton Jr. signed a two-way contract with the Memphis Grizzlies after going undrafted in the 2022 NBA draft.

March 2022 Kenneth Lofton Jr. declared for the 2022 NBA draft, while not signing with an agent, thus retaining the option to return to Louisiana Tech.

2021 In the gold medal game against France, Lofton led the US team with 16 points, 15 of which came in the second half, securing a come-from-behind victory with a final score of 83–81.
2021 Kenneth Lofton Jr. represented the United States at the FIBA Under-19 World Cup in Latvia, where he averaged 13.1 points and 5.3 rebounds per game, contributing to the team's gold medal victory.

March 28 2021 Kenneth Lofton Jr. recorded a freshman season-high 27 points and 13 rebounds, making a game-winning shot with 0.3 seconds left in a 76–74 victory over Colorado State at the National Invitational Tournament (NIT) third place game. He was selected for the All-Tournament Team.
